Q&A

How do I treat invasive species without harming the local watershed?

Targeted manual removal of invasive plants during early growth stages avoids herbicide runoff into Cameron Park Lake watersheds. Mechanical extraction followed by native species planting creates competitive exclusion. Any necessary treatments follow State Water Resources Control Board guidelines for application timing and buffer zones. Soil testing determines precise amendment needs rather than blanket fertilization that could violate local ordinances.

What solutions prevent runoff in my clay-heavy Cameron Park yard?

Acidic Aiken loam's clay subsoil creates moderate runoff that requires engineered drainage solutions. Permeable decomposed granite pathways and flagstone patios with gravel joints increase surface infiltration rates. These materials meet El Dorado County Planning & Building Department standards for stormwater management by reducing impervious surfaces. French drains connected to dry wells provide additional subsurface water movement capacity.

What permits and licenses are required for regrading my 0.35-acre property?

Grading projects exceeding 50 cubic yards require El Dorado County Planning & Building Department permits with engineered drainage plans. Contractors must hold California CSLB licenses with C-27 landscaping classification for earthmoving work. Property size determines stormwater management requirements, with 0.35-acre lots often needing infiltration basins or swales. Unlicensed grading risks significant fines and may void property insurance in high-fire zones.

Are decomposed granite and flagstone worth the extra cost over wood decking?

Decomposed granite and flagstone provide superior longevity with minimal maintenance compared to wood alternatives that require regular sealing and replacement. These non-combustible materials contribute to defensible space requirements in Very High fire risk zones. Their thermal mass moderates microclimate temperatures, and proper installation creates stable surfaces that resist frost heave in USDA Zone 9b conditions.

Why does my Cameron Park Estates lawn struggle despite regular watering?

Homes built around 1987 have acidic Aiken loam soil that has matured for nearly 40 years, developing a compacted clay-heavy subsoil layer. This acidic pH of 5.5-6.5 reduces nutrient availability and creates poor soil percolation. Core aeration with organic amendments like composted bark improves permeability and introduces beneficial mycorrhizae. Addressing these soil structure issues is more effective than increasing irrigation frequency.

Can I maintain a healthy Tall Fescue lawn under Stage 1 water restrictions?

Wi-Fi ET-based weather sensing controllers adjust irrigation schedules using real-time evapotranspiration data, reducing water use by 15-25% while preserving dwarf Tall Fescue varieties. These systems automatically skip cycles during rainfall events and reduce runtime during cooler periods. This technology meets voluntary conservation targets while maintaining turf health through precise moisture management at root zone depth.

What low-maintenance alternatives work for noise-restricted neighborhoods?

Replacing high-maintenance turf with California Poppy, Western Redbud, and Ceanothus natives reduces mowing frequency and eliminates gas blower use ahead of pending electric equipment mandates. Deergrass and Valley Oak plantings require minimal irrigation once established and provide year-round habitat value. This approach aligns with 2026 biodiversity standards while creating fire-resistant landscaping in Very High WUI Zone 2 areas.
